What is the Executor or Executrix
The terms "executor" and "executrix" refer to individuals appointed to manage the estate of a deceased person. An executor is typically male, while an executrix is female, although the term "executor" is often used as a gender-neutral term in modern contexts. Their primary responsibility is to ensure that the deceased's wishes, as outlined in their will, are carried out. This includes settling debts, distributing assets to beneficiaries, and handling any legal matters related to the estate.

Legal Use of the Executor or Executrix
The role of an executor or executrix is legally defined and comes with specific responsibilities. They must act in the best interest of the estate and its beneficiaries, adhering to the laws governing estate management in their state. This includes filing necessary documents with the court, paying any outstanding debts or taxes, and ensuring that the estate is settled in a timely manner. Failure to comply with these legal obligations can result in penalties or legal action against the executor or executrix.
Key Elements of the Executor or Executrix
Several key elements define the role of an executor or executrix. These include the authority to manage the deceased's assets, the responsibility to notify beneficiaries, and the duty to file the will with the probate court. Additionally, they must keep accurate records of all transactions and communications related to the estate. Transparency and accountability are crucial, as beneficiaries have the right to receive updates on the estate's status and financial matters.

Examples of Using the Executor or Executrix
In practice, an executor or executrix may face various scenarios. For example, they might need to sell real estate owned by the deceased to pay off debts or distribute personal belongings according to the will. Another example is managing ongoing financial accounts, such as closing bank accounts or transferring assets to beneficiaries. Each situation requires careful consideration and adherence to legal protocols to ensure the estate is handled appropriately.
